Woman killed in Coon Rapids crash identified as from Anoka

March 7, 2015 at 1:46AM

An 84-year-old woman killed in a traffic crash Thursday afternoon in Coon Rapids has been identified as Donna Mae Youso.

Youso, of Anoka, was driving east on Coon Rapids Boulevard at 3 p.m. when she crossed the centerline after being hit from behind by another vehicle. Youso's vehicle then collided with a westbound minivan, according to the Anoka County Sheriff's Office.

Youso was taken to a hospital, where she died.

The driver of the minivan, a 61-year-old woman from Coon Rapids, was treated for noncritical injuries at Mercy Hospital.

According to the Sheriff's Office, a driver of a vehicle making a left turn from Coon Rapids Blvd. Extension onto Coon Rapids Blvd. immediately moved into the right lane after completing the turn. That vehicle then clipped the back of Youso's car, sending it across the centerline and into the path of the minivan, said Cmdr. Paul Sommer.

The driver of that vehicle was not hurt.
